Today, 22 December 2020 marks the 1st anniversary of the passing of Venerable Dhammavuddho Mahāthera.  Nalanda pays tribute to Venerable who dedicated his life to seeking the path to Liberation and resolutely expounding on the original teachings of the Buddha to the masses.

The late Ven. Dhammavuddho was the founding abbot of Vihara Buddha Gotama and an inspiring Dhamma teacher to many monks and lay Buddhists.  His legacy is of a life well-lived; persevering through formidable obstacles in order to learn the Buddha’s teachings, recording expositions on the five Nikāyas systematically, and authoring numerous Dhamma books for earnest seekers of Truth.

We can honour his life and mission by recollecting his sagacious advices throughout the years and investigating the Buddha’s teachings in order to develop wisdom and insight.  With reverence and gratitude, we wish Ven. Dhammavuddho the highest blessings of Peace.  May He attain the final bliss of Nibbāna.

We definitely cannot alter what has been sown in our past, but by skilfully exercising wisdom, loving-kindness and compassion in our present actions, we can surely determine a future in line with our hopes and aspiration.  We can help ourselves by sincerely embarking on this journey of transformation and with the greatest love for ourselves.  For who else can help us but ourselves.

– Excerpt from “Only We can Help Ourselves” by Venerable Dhammavuddho
